How To Get Rid Of Sugar Ants?

Barney Bryan
Barney Bryan

I have been dealing with a persistent sugar ant infestation in my house, and despite trying various methods, I cannot seem to eliminate them completely. I’m seeking effective suggestions or approaches that have successfully worked for others in getting rid of sugar ants once and for all.

    Vinegar solution is a highly effective and budget-friendly method to get rid of sugar ants. This natural remedy makes use of the strong scent of white vinegar to repel ants and prevent them from entering your home. To make the vinegar solution, simply mix equal parts of white vinegar and water in a spray bottle.

    Once you have the solution prepared, spray it along ant trails, windowsills, and baseboards – basically, any areas where you notice ant activity. The strong scent of the vinegar acts as a deterrent, making ants avoid crossing the barrier created by the solution.

    It’s important to mention that this vinegar solution should not be used on surfaces that are sensitive to acidic substances, such as marble or granite countertops. In those cases, you can consider using alternative solutions like lemon juice diluted with water.

    In addition to spraying the vinegar solution, it is recommended to also address the cause of the ant infestation. Seal off any cracks or openings that serve as entry points for the ants. Furthermore, keep your space clean, removing any food sources that may attract the ants.

    By combining these preventive measures with the vinegar solution, you can effectively keep sugar ants at bay without relying on harmful chemicals. If, after attempting these DIY methods, the ant infestation persists, it may be necessary to seek the assistance of a professional pest control company.

    Diatomaceous earth is a highly effective method for getting rid of sugar ants. This natural insecticide is made from fossilized algae and acts as a powerful deterrent against ants. The powdery substance can be sprinkled near ant trails or on ant mounds to control and eliminate the infestation.

    When sugar ants come into contact with diatomaceous earth, it dehydrates their exoskeletons and causes them to perish. It works by puncturing the outer layer of the ants, ultimately leading to their demise. One of the advantages of diatomaceous earth is that it specifically targets ants and does not pose any harm to humans or pets.

    To use diatomaceous earth effectively, identify areas where you frequently spot sugar ants or their entry points. Sprinkle a thin layer of food-grade diatomaceous earth around these areas to create a physical barrier that the ants cannot easily pass through. Make sure to cover all ant trails and mounds that you come across.

    Remember to wear a mask and gloves when handling diatomaceous earth to prevent inhalation. Additionally, opt for food-grade diatomaceous earth, which is safe to use around food storage and preparation areas. This natural and non-toxic solution offers a long-lasting protection against sugar ants without harming other beneficial insects or the environment.

    If traditional methods like cinnamon, traps, or vinegar solutions have proven ineffective against your sugar ant problem, diatomaceous earth may be just the solution you need. Give it a try and effectively eliminate those unwanted invaders from your home.

    To effectively get rid of sugar ants, you can set traps in strategic areas to attract and trap them. Sweet baits are particularly effective, as they are irresistibly enticing to sugar ants. One option is to create a mixture of borax and powdered sugar and place it in areas where you frequently spot these pesky invaders. Another alternative is to mix honey and water to form a sticky trap.

    It’s important to strategically position the traps near ant entry points or where you’ve seen the most ant activity. This will increase the chances of the ants discovering and being drawn to the bait. The borax and powdered sugar mixture prove to be lethal to the ants since sugar is their desired food source, and the borax acts as a toxin to eliminate them.

    Do keep in mind that it may take some time for the traps to work effectively. Patience is key when dealing with sugar ant infestations, as it might require multiple trap placements before significant results are seen. Also, ensure that other food sources in your home are properly stored, as this will minimize competition for the traps and increase their effectiveness.

    To get rid of sugar ants, there are several effective methods you can try. One natural deterrent is to sprinkle cinnamon or black pepper near ant entry points. The strong scent repels sugar ants and discourages them from coming into your space. Another option is to set traps using sweet baits like a mixture of borax and powdered sugar or honey and water. Place these baits strategically in areas where ants are usually seen, and they will be attracted to the sweetness and get trapped.

    It’s also important to seal off their entry points. Check for cracks or openings in your home where ants may be entering and seal them with caulk or weatherstripping. This prevents their entry and keeps them out. Additionally, maintaining cleanliness is crucial. Remove any food sources that might attract sugar ants by properly storing food in airtight containers and cleaning up crumbs regularly.

    Other methods to try include using a vinegar solution, spraying equal parts white vinegar and water along ant trails, windowsills, and baseboards, as ants dislike the scent. Coffee grounds can also be effective, as sugar ants dislike the smell, so spreading used coffee grounds in areas where you often spot them may keep them away. Diatomaceous earth, a powdery substance made from fossilized algae, acts as a natural insecticide when sprinkled near ant trails or mounds.

    You can also try making an essential oil spray by mixing a few drops of peppermint oil or tea tree oil with water and spraying it on ant-infested areas. The strong smell repels ants and acts as a repellent. If all else fails, consider calling a professional exterminator who can help eliminate the infestation. Lastly, adopting preventive measures like regularly inspecting your home for possible entry points, fixing leaks or moisture issues, and maintaining a clean environment will discourage future sugar ant invasions.
